Understanding Mental Wellness
Mental wellness is a state of well-being where you feel good emotionally, psychologically, and socially. It affects how you think, feel, and act. It also influences how you handle stress, relate to others, and make choices.
Here are some key components of mental wellness:
Emotional Awareness: Understanding your feelings and emotions is crucial. It helps you respond to situations in a healthy way.
Stress Management: Learning how to cope with stress is essential. Effective stress management techniques can improve your overall well-being.
Resilience: Building resilience allows you to bounce back from challenges. It helps you face life's ups and downs with confidence.
Healthy Relationships: Connecting with others is vital for mental wellness. Positive relationships can provide support and enhance your emotional health.
By focusing on these components, you can create a solid foundation for your mental wellness journey.

Practical Tips for Mental Wellness
In addition to seeking professional help, there are practical steps you can take to enhance your mental wellness. Here are some tips to consider:
Practice Mindfulness: Mindfulness involves being present in the moment. Techniques such as meditation and deep breathing can help reduce stress and improve focus.
Stay Active: Regular physical activity is essential for mental wellness. Exercise releases endorphins, which can boost your mood.
Connect with Others: Make time for friends and family. Building strong relationships can provide support and enhance your emotional health.
Set Realistic Goals: Setting achievable goals can give you a sense of purpose. Break larger goals into smaller, manageable steps.
Prioritize Self-Care: Take time for yourself. Engage in activities that bring you joy and relaxation, whether it is reading, gardening, or taking a bath.
Incorporating these tips into your daily routine can help you maintain your mental wellness.

Overcoming Stigma Around Mental Health
Despite the growing awareness of mental health, stigma still exists. Many people feel ashamed or embarrassed to seek help. It is essential to challenge these misconceptions and promote a more positive view of mental wellness.
Here are some ways to combat stigma:
Educate Yourself and Others: Understanding mental health issues can help reduce stigma. Share your knowledge with friends and family to promote awareness.
Speak Openly: Talking about mental health can help normalize the conversation. Share your experiences and encourage others to do the same.
Support Others: Be an ally to those struggling with mental health issues. Offer your support and understanding to friends and family.
Advocate for Change: Support initiatives that promote mental health awareness. Advocate for policies that improve access to mental health services.
By working together to combat stigma, we can create a more supportive environment for mental wellness.
